AI Contract Overview
The contract mandates the manufacture and supply of five military-spec push button units with designated part and NSN numbers, ensuring full compliance with Department of Defense standards for packaging, labeling, and hazardous materials handling as defined by the Defense Logistics Agency. All components must meet exacting military specifications to guarantee operational reliability and safety in demanding environments, with adherence to DLA requirements being non-negotiable. Performance is to be executed with delivery to the specified location in New Cumberland, Pennsylvania, 17070-5002, and the contract is structured as a subcontract under NAICS code 334419, indicating specialization in other electronic component manufacturing. The solicitation was posted on July 21, 2026, with responses due by August 3, 2026, and is managed by the Electrical Devices Division of the Department of Defense. Bidders must be prepared to demonstrate compliance with all technical, logistical, and regulatory conditions tied to the delivery of these mission-critical components.
